Comparing Mongolia with Rutland, Vermont

Compare Climate information for Mongolia and Rutland, Vermont

Is Mongolia warmer or hotter than Rutland, Vermont?

On average across the year, no, Mongolia is not hotter than Rutland, Vermont . Mongolia has an average temperature of 1°C/34°F and Rutland, Vermont has an average temperature of 7°C/45°F.

Mongolia's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 26°C/79°F, which is not hotter than Rutland, Vermont's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 27°C/81°F).

Is Mongolia colder or cooler than Rutland, Vermont?

On average across the year, yes, Mongolia is colder than Rutland, Vermont . Mongolia has an average minimum temperature of -5°C/23°F and Rutland, Vermont has an average minimum temperature of 1°C/34°F.



Mongolia's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-24°C/-11°F, which is colder than Rutland, Vermont's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-12°C/10°F).

Does Mongolia have more rain than Rutland, Vermont?

On average across the year, no, Mongolia has less rain than Rutland, Vermont. Mongolia has an average annual rainfall of 151mm and Rutland, Vermont has an average annual rainfall of 1070mm.

Mongolia's wettest month is July, with an average monthly rainfall of 41mm, which is drier than Rutland, Vermont's wettest month (June, with an average monthly rainfall of 118mm).
